Jennifer Lawrence paraded her endless legs outside her New York City hotel prior to attending the “China: Through the Looking Glass” Costume Institute Benefit Gala at the Metropolitan Museum of the Art on Monday.

The 24-year-old actress’ off-duty looks are usually very laid-back and typically include a pair of pants, flat shoes, and a simple top.

But on Monday afternoon, she decided on a feminine and head-turning white tiered mini dress, which displayed her toned legs. The Hunger Games star looked lovely in her frock, which is a style she seldom wears for casual outings.

Keeping the overall look simple, she pulled her hair up into a messy bun and wore minimal makeup while shielding her eyes behind a pair of Tom Ford cat-eye sunglasses.

The award-winning actress finished off her effortless look with a pair of Gianvito Rossi sandals featuring slingback straps with silver-tone roller buckles and grommet eyelets, open toes, covered vamps, and 4-inch cork-covered chunky heels, which are on-trend this spring.

Check out Jennifer Lawrence’s Christian Dior gown at the Met Gala 2015. The very oriental dress features a floral bodice that goes down the back of the black fitted skirt, a contrasting yoke, and cutout detail.

It was perfect for the Asian-themed event, but many thought it was a bit underwhelming considering that the actress was chosen as the co-host that evening. Jennifer finished off her look with Cartier jewels and a pair of Roger Vivier heels.
